I rowed a Century yesterday and was pleasantly surprised that we can now set it up via the PM5 as a "single distance" and it provides splits every 20k and a projected time to finish. THANK YOU CONCEPT2! They must have just made this change in the last year? No more setting it up as a single interval...

I have ankle issues too, like Ollie. With a plate and 5 screws in my right ankle (motocross injury),it will start to ache with too much ankle flexion. I focus on keeping my shins vertical with each and every stroke. I made it through the 100k with no pain there. Looking at the doing the entire 100k ...
